Ordinals
beta
Sat 768923095142940
decimal
25699.4295142940
percentile
1.53784619028588%
name
mjshkzdcyjmr
cycle
0
epoch
2
block
25699
offset
4295142940
timestamp
2023-12-28 06:21:53 UTC
rarity
common
prev
next